Easter Egg - Totaka's Song

Totaka's Song is a simple 19-note melody that Kazumi Totaka has inserted into a few games that he has composed for. Animal Crossing: City Folk is one of them. In fact it's in this game twice. The first place that it's in is very easy to access, since it is a song by K.K. Slider. The name of this song is "K.K. Song". The second place it is in is Kapp'n's bus. Don't go through any of thee text, not even the first message, and it will play eventually, assumingly as a whistle being made by Kapp'n. Totaka's Song has appeared in 9 games, if not more, and is usually found by waiting for a somewhat long period of time (ranging from 1 minute and 15 seconds to 4 minutes) or by selecting a certain option (The O in "Mario" in Mario Paint). Interestingly, K.K. Slider's real name is Totakeke, and is a portmanteau of "Totaka" and the pronunciation of "K.K.". |
